Kitsch or Art? In Aalen, good taste is put to an exciting test
The Gallery in the Town Hall of Aalen invites you to an exhibition in summer 2026 that not only showcases art but sharpens perception: Kitsch or Art? addresses one of the oldest and simultaneously most vibrant judgments in the contemplation of art. Between mountain landscapes and roaring stags, between pleasing surfaces and aesthetic depth, an art experience emerges that encourages visitors to take a closer look. Why this exhibition changes perspective
The exhibition takes the famous narrow ridge between high art and profane imagery seriously. It questions assessment patterns, viewing habits, and the cultural knowledge that shapes our ideas about beautiful art. This is precisely where its strength lies: what seems light becomes the subject of precise artwork contemplation, and the term kitsch does not appear as a devaluation but as an invitation to reflection. Between irony, longing, and cultural memory
The title opens a space where irony and seriousness touch. Kitsch, in this sense, is not merely a counter-concept but a cultural symptom: it speaks of longings, of popular imagery, and of the question of why some motifs are read as appealing while others are seen as trivial. Those who visit the exhibition do not experience a dogmatic answer but a thoughtful invitation to self-interrogation. Key data for the visit
The opening will take place on Friday, July 24, 2026, at 6:30 PM. The exhibition runs from July 24 to September 6, 2026, at the Gallery in the Town Hall of Aalen, Marktplatz 30, 73430 Aalen. The gallery's opening hours are Monday to Wednesday from 8:30 AM to 5 PM, Thursday until 6 PM, Friday from 8:30 AM to 12 PM and 2 PM to 5 PM, as well as Saturday from 10 AM to 1 PM and Sunday and public holidays from 2 PM to 5 PM. For the gallery, free visits without admission have been mentioned in the municipal information; therefore, it can be assumed that entry is free for this exhibition.
